1. Lower Production Costs

Making perfumes from scratch costs a lot of money. You need expensive laboratory gear and scientists. Sourcing directly from perfume suppliers cuts these extra steps out. You receive pre-made, high-quality fragrance oils. This lowers your setup bills. Your brand can use that saved cash for marketing and beautiful packaging.

2. Faster Product Launches

Creating a unique scent formula can take many months or even years. When you buy from wholesale channels, the oils are ready for immediate use. You can launch a brand-new summer scent line in just weeks. Staying fast lets you jump on hot social media trends before they cool down.

3. Freedom to Test Small Batches

Big perfume factories often force you to buy thousands of bottles at once. Top wholesale suppliers offer much lower minimum orders. This lets you test a new unisex scent safely. If your customers love it, you can order a larger amount next time. If they do not, you do not lose a lot of money.

4. Easy Customization Options

You can mix different standard oils to create a unique blend just for your brand. For example, you can add a sweet vanilla oil to a woody base oil. This gives you a signature scent that nobody else sells. It helps your brand look distinct, expensive, and professional.

5. Better Profit Margins

Buying in large bulk always reduces your price per ounce. Because perfume oils are highly concentrated, a single bulk jug makes hundreds of retail bottles. You buy the ingredients at a low price and sell the finished products at a high retail price. This creates excellent profit margins for your company.

7. Simple Shipping and Storage

Alcohol-based liquid perfumes are highly flammable. This makes shipping them by air very hard and expensive. Pure oils do not contain alcohol, so they do not burn easily. They are much safer and cheaper to ship globally. They also take up very little space in your storage warehouse.

8. High Customer Loyalty

Pure oils last much longer on human skin than cheap alcohol sprays. A customer can apply a day scent in the morning and still smell it at night. When buyers notice your products last all day, they trust your quality. This high satisfaction keeps them buying from your shop for years.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is the main difference between perfume oil and standard perfume?

Standard perfumes contain a lot of alcohol and water mixed with a little fragrance. Perfume oils are pure, highly concentrated scent blends with zero alcohol. They do not dry out human skin, and their smell lasts much longer.

Can I use wholesale perfume oils directly on my skin?

Yes, most pure perfume oils are safe for human skin. However, it is always smart to dilute them with a plain carrier oil like jojoba oil or coconut oil before selling them to customers.

How should I store bulk perfume oils to keep them fresh?

Always store your bulk oils inside dark glass bottles. Keep the bottles in a cool, dark, and dry spot away from direct sunlight. This keeps the scent strong for up to two years.

Do I need a special license to buy perfume oils in bulk?

Most wholesale suppliers allow you to buy bulk quantities without a special commercial license. You just need to create an online account on their official website to start ordering.

Can I use these fragrance oils in soy candles and soaps?

Yes. High-quality fragrance oils are versatile. They can withstand the high heat needed for making wax candles and cold-process soaps without losing their lovely smell.

What does "unisex scent" mean in the fragrance industry?

A unisex scent is a neutral fragrance blend that smells great on both men and women. Good examples include fresh marine notes, clean laundry notes, and warm amber smells.

Why are my perfume oils changing color over time?

Natural ingredients like vanilla or sweet citrus can turn darker when exposed to air and light. This color change is completely normal and does not mean the scent is ruined.

What is a low minimum order quantity (MOQ)?

An MOQ is the lowest amount of product a supplier allows you to buy per order. A low MOQ is great for small brands because they can buy just a few bottles to test first.

How do I make my own signature scent blend?

You can buy separate notes like rose, musk, and lemon from your supplier. Mix small drops of them in a clean vial until you find a balanced blend you love.
